2260  Bitcoin / Group buys / Re: [OPEN] batch #20/21 .31 - .35 btc for USB miners & 10.25 blades - USA only on: August 12, 2013, 03:38:11 AM
From you.. YES
From another reseller... NO
That's why I came back to you.
#1 you matched the price
#2 Every single one of the units I have ever purchased from you were factory tamper sticker in place <<#2 is very important trust level to me. As a distributer I felt it was unethical to have units that have been sold as NEW yet the stickers were gone or folded in like maybe they were "TESTED"

In the end I just threw down $6200 USD in your hands due to #2 being very important to me.
I've bought from Canary, and I've bought from two other sources.  Both of those sources explicitly stated they were testing the units before shipping so it was no surprise to find the seals broken.  Nothing untoward as far as I can see.  They didn't have the experience at the time of warranty processes and simply wanted to ensure they didn't ship dead product.
I only saw btcguild state openly about testing.  Btcguild did testing very early on as an added bonus which was great but its not feasible with high volume and they announced that they were stopping testing.. Very open and honest about it.  I thought about testing but its unnecessary because resellers receive extra inventory for warranty handling. Technically, they are no longer unused if tested and this would violate eBay/amazon "new" condition for those of you who buy in bulk to resell further.
friedcat includes extras for warranty claims.   I've had to do warranty replacements and this process is better than testing each unit before shipping...when you buy one of these you want it hashing for YOU ASAP, not anyone else.
Now if a reseller is custom branding these, then they have to be opened, but this would be public info.
